Fairfield Horse Market Tops Year As Local Sellers Shine

Miss Margaret Stevenson celebrated her birthday at North Court Street with friends and gifts. The local horse market peaked last Thursday as Paul Brent sold a horse for 310 dollars, raised by Henry Rider, signaling rising Jefferson county demand and strong buyer interest from major firms.

Fairfield Notes Highlights From City Life And Events

Local items cover births, a Quiet wedding in Stockport, damage by stray dogs, depot grading and sewer work, a planned city baseball league, cement curb paving and water-works upgrades, hospital progress, and new Halladay cars with a citywide tour. Includes Chautauqua concert plans and nursery tent, and a July Fourth shift.

Real Estate Transfers and Ice Plant Update

A series of real estate transfers from Greeson, Casady, McIntire and others is listed with July dates and amounts. The article notes improvements at a new ice plant, including a 1400 foot well, 100 gallons per minute pumping, a reliable air lift pump, and plans for July operation. It also previews Fairfield Chautauqua events and a notice about the 1911 School Law copies.

City sends buyers to appraise apples before purchase

A city program requires an official purchaser to inspect orchard apples rather than accepting owner statements. The procedure ensures fair value and avoids misrepresentation in sales to the municipal buyer.
